Victor M. Ormsby, 86, of Durant, died Monday August 18, 1986, at Oak Glen Home Nursing Home in Coal Valley, Illinois.

Visitation will be 4:00 to 8:00 p.m., Wednesday, August 20, at Lacock Funeral Home in Durant. Memorials may be made to the Durant Volunteer Fire Department or the Durant Community Center in his memory.

Funeral services will be 10:30 a.m., Thursday, August 21, at Lacock Funeral Home in Durant, with Rev. Mark Holmer officiating. Pallbearers are Robert Ploen, Earl Ormsby, Paul Schmelzer, Victor Wulf, Edward Huesmann and Wendell Cox. Burial will be in the Durant Cemetery, Durant, Iowa.

Raymond Marmaduke Ormsby was born June 6, 1900, in Stockton, the son of Marmaduke and Augusta (Becker) Ormsby. He received his education the Stockton schools. He married Dorinda M. Trede on September 6, 1928, in Davenport. Together they farmed in Muscatine County, until they retired in 1961 and moved to Durant. Dorinda preceded him in death on July 26, 1980. He later became a resident of Oak Glen Home Nursing Home in Coal Valley. He was a member of the Durant Senior Citizens.

He is survived by one daughter, Marian Knock of Moline, IL; three grandchildren; two great-grandchildren; two brothers, Henry (Irene) Ormsby of Stanwood and Lloyd Ormsby of Blue Grass; and two sisters-in-law, Dorothy Ormsby and Ethel Ormsby, both of Davenport.

He was preceded in death by his parents, his wife, one son-in-law, Ralph Knock, three brothers, George, Frank and Arthur Ormsby and one sister-in-law, Pearl Ormsby.

Wilton Advocate News, Aug 21, 1986
